Cost Range for Materials - The cost of materials for an ADA ramp installation typically ranges from $200 to $800, depending on the type of materials used and the length of the ramp. For example, basic aluminum or wood ramps may fall on the lower end, while custom or durable materials tend to be more expensive.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ing an ADA ramp generally range from $300 to $1,200. The total depends on the complexity of the project, site conditions, and local labor rates in Monument, CO, and nearby areas.
Total Project Cost - Overall, the complete installation of an ADA ramp can cost between $500 and $2,000. This includes both materials and labor, with variations based on size and customization requirements.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, site preparation, or modifications, which can add $100 to $500 to the total project.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Are there different types of ADA ramps available? Yes, ADA ramps come in various styles, including modular, permanent, and portable options. Local providers can help determine the best type for a given location.
What materials are commonly used for ADA ramps? Common materials include aluminum, concrete, wood, and rubber. Local pros can advise on the most suitable materials based on durability and location.
